7. What conditions require that this work be done?The 1983 Nevada Legislature mandated certain rights and guarantees to crime victims and witnesses. Accordingly, Chapter178 of the Nevada Revised Statutes recognizes the needs and rights of crime victims. Among other provisions, Chapter 178mandates that a victim be notified by law enforcement of the location of the defendant following arrest, during prosecution ofthe criminal case, during a sentence to confinement, and when there is any release or escape of the defendant fromconfinement.

7. What conditions require that this work be done?While the Debt Collection staff is doing the best they can with the tools they have, there is much room for improvement. Thenew module will automate our existing processes, and allow the staff to focus their time on collection efforts instead oftracking data. The new module also has tools to process debt through the Treasury Offset Program (TOP), update debtorinformation, implement and manage levy and garnishment processes, implement the Financial Institute Data Match process(FIDM), establish self-service case resolution (debtor payments by phone, etc.), implement enhanced private collectionagency (PCA) management, and implement enhanced management and AR reporting.

Why was this contractor chosen in preference to other?CGI Technologies and Solutions Inc. owns the Advantage financial system software that the State of Nevada uses in itsIntegrated Financial System. The Advantage software system is a proprietary system. Part of the implementation processwill be to integrate the Advantage Collections software module into the existing Advantage system. Other debt collectionsoftware vendors would have to provide a comparable system or build an interface to the CGI Advantage System to meet ourneeds, thereby increasing the cost of their solution. CGI has proposed to implement the Collections module at their expense,and only be compensated when the system actually begins to generate increases of debt collection revenue to the DebtRecovery Account. What conditions require that this work be done?The Black Mountain Industrial (BMI) complex in Henderson, Nevada has been the site of industrial chemical production since1942 by various companies including the U.S. Government for the World War 2 effort. A contaminant from these activities,perchlorate, was discovered in the Las Vegas Wash and prompted further investigation by NDEP. NDEP's planned futureremediation activities will require the data from USGS that will be provided through this agreement.
